Yellowtail

word

1. Noun

Any one of several species of marine carangoid fishes of the genus Seriola; especially, the large California species (S. dorsalis) which sometimes weighs thirty or forty pounds, and is highly esteemed as a food fish; -- called also cavasina, and white salmon.

2. Noun

The mademoiselle, or silver perch.

3. Noun

The menhaden.

4. Noun

The runner, 12.

5. Noun

A California rockfish (Sebastodes flavidus).

6. Noun

The sailor's choice (Diplodus rhomboides).

7. Noun

game fish of southern California and Mexico having a yellow tail fin
